// Copyright (c) Microsoft Corporation. All rights reserved. // Licensed under the MIT License. package tag import ( "context" "fmt" "github.com/Azure/acr-cli/acr" "github.com/Azure/acr-cli/internal/api" "github.com/pkg/errors" ) type ListTagsError struct { msg string } func (e *ListTagsError) Error() string { return e.msg } // ListTags will do the http requests and return the digest of all the tags in the selected repository. func ListTags(ctx context.Context, acrClient api.AcrCLIClientInterface, repoName string) ([]acr.TagAttributesBase, error) { lastTag := "" resultTags, err := acrClient.GetAcrTags(ctx, repoName, "", lastTag) if err != nil { return nil, errors.Wrap(&ListTagsError{msg: "failed to list tags"}, err.Error()) } var tagList []acr.TagAttributesBase tagList = append(tagList, *resultTags.TagsAttributes...) // A for loop is used because the GetAcrTags method returns by default only 100 tags and their attributes. for resultTags != nil && resultTags.TagsAttributes != nil { tags := *resultTags.TagsAttributes // Since the GetAcrTags supports pagination when supplied with the last digest that was returned the last tag name // digest is saved, the tag array contains at least one element because if it was empty the API would return // a nil pointer instead of a pointer to a length 0 array. lastTag = *tags[len(tags)-1].Name resultTags, err = acrClient.GetAcrTags(ctx, repoName, "", lastTag) if err != nil { return nil, err } if resultTags != nil && resultTags.TagsAttributes != nil { tagList = append(tagList, *resultTags.TagsAttributes...) } } return tagList, nil } // DeleteTags receives an array of tags digest and deletes them using the supplied acrClient. func DeleteTags(ctx context.Context, acrClient api.AcrCLIClientInterface, loginURL string, repoName string, tags []string) error { for i := 0; i < len(tags); i++ { _, err := acrClient.DeleteAcrTag(ctx, repoName, tags[i]) if err != nil { // If there is an error (this includes not found and not allowed operations) the deletion of the tags is stopped and an error is returned. return errors.Wrap(err, "failed to delete tags") } fmt.Printf("%s/%s:%s\n", loginURL, repoName, tags[i]) } return nil }
